Penne with purple artichokes


Penne with purple artichokes
In this recipe, the purple artichokes are braised in white wine, then mixed with the penne and parmesan.

Step by step recipe


Stage 1 - ⌛ 20 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 1
Prepare 6 purples globe artichokes.

Stage 2 - ⌛ 5 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 2
Pour 2 tablespoons olive oil into a frying pan on high heat. When really hot, add the artichokes and sauter briefly, just until they are lightly browned all over.

Stage 3 - ⌛ 5 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 3
Add 1 sprig thyme to the pan with 1 garlic clove and 1 shallot (peeled and chopped).

Stage 4 - ⌛ 1 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 4
Pour in 2 glasses dry white wine, salt and pepper, then turn down the heat and leave to cook...

Stage 5 - ⌛ 10 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 5
...until the white wine has completely evaporated.

Set aside.

Stage 6 - ⌛ 8 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 6
Cook 400 g Pasta (penne).

Stage 7 - ⌛ 1 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 7
Mix the pasta and artichokes (remove the thyme and discard it), add a trickle of olive oil...

Stage 8 - ⌛ 2 min.
Penne with purple artichokes : Stage 8
...and the grated 50 g Parmesan (Parmigiano Reggiano).

Mix and serve piping hot.
Remarks
You can replace the penne with any pasta you like.
Keeping: A few days in the fridge, covered with plastic film.
